Agrinio (Greek: Αγρίνιο, articulated [aˈɣrinio], Latin: Agrinium) is the largest city of the Aetolia-Acarnania local unit of Greece and its biggest municipality, with 106,053 occupants. It is the economical facility of Aetolia-Acarnania, although its capital is the town of Mesolonghi. The negotiation goes back to ancient times. Ancient Agrinion was 3 kilometres (2 miles) northeast of today city; some walls and structures of which have been excavated. In middle ages times and until 1836, the city was called Vrachori (Βραχώρι).
